Titanium disc bolts are a crucial component in various applications, particularly in the automotive and cycling industries. These bolts are designed to secure disc rotors to wheels, ensuring that the braking system functions effectively. The importance of reliable braking cannot be overstated, as it directly impacts safety and performance. In this article, we will explore the characteristics, benefits, and applications of titanium disc bolts, as well as address common questions surrounding their use.
Titanium disc bolts are fasteners made from titanium, a metal known for its high strength-to-weight ratio, corrosion resistance, and durability. These bolts are typically used in high-performance vehicles and bicycles, where reducing weight without compromising strength is essential. The most common type of titanium used for these bolts is Grade 5 titanium, which is an alloy of titanium, aluminum, and vanadium. This specific alloy is favored for its excellent mechanical properties, making it suitable for demanding applications where reliability is critical.
Titanium is a transition metal that is both lightweight and strong. It is resistant to corrosion, making it ideal for use in environments that may expose it to moisture and other corrosive elements. The alloying elements in Grade 5 titanium enhance its mechanical properties, making it suitable for demanding applications. The unique properties of titanium stem from its atomic structure, which allows it to maintain strength at high temperatures while remaining lightweight. This makes titanium an ideal choice for applications in extreme conditions, such as racing or off-road cycling.

When selecting titanium disc bolts, it is essential to consider the size and specifications required for your application. Common sizes include M6, M8, and M10, with varying lengths and thread pitches. Always refer to the manufacturer's guidelines to ensure compatibility. Using the correct size is crucial for maintaining the integrity of the braking system, as improperly sized bolts can lead to failure or reduced performance. Additionally, understanding the specific requirements of your vehicle or bicycle will help you make an informed decision.
Not all titanium bolts are created equal. It is crucial to choose bolts from reputable manufacturers who adhere to industry standards. Look for certifications that guarantee the quality and performance of the bolts. High-quality titanium bolts undergo rigorous testing to ensure they meet safety and performance standards. Investing in certified products can prevent potential failures and enhance the overall reliability of your braking system.
While titanium disc bolts offer numerous benefits, they can be more expensive than traditional steel bolts. It is essential to weigh the performance advantages against the cost when making a decision. For many enthusiasts, the benefits of reduced weight and increased durability justify the higher price. However, for casual users, standard steel bolts may suffice. Understanding your specific needs and budget will help you make the best choice for your application.
Proper installation of titanium disc bolts is critical to ensure their effectiveness. Here are some tips for installation:
- Use a torque wrench to apply the correct torque settings as specified by the manufacturer. This ensures that the bolts are tightened to the appropriate level, preventing loosening during use.
- Ensure that the threads are clean and free from debris before installation. Contaminants can interfere with the bolt's grip and lead to failure.
- Consider using a thread-locking compound to prevent loosening due to vibrations. This additional measure can enhance the reliability of the installation, especially in high-vibration environments.
Titanium disc bolts require minimal maintenance due to their corrosion resistance. However, it is advisable to periodically check the bolts for tightness and inspect them for any signs of wear or damage. Regular maintenance can help identify potential issues before they become serious problems, ensuring the longevity and reliability of your braking system. Additionally, keeping the bolts clean and free from debris will help maintain their performance over time.

Titanium disc bolts are lighter and more corrosion-resistant than steel bolts. While steel bolts may be stronger in some applications, titanium offers a better strength-to-weight ratio, making it ideal for performance applications. The choice between titanium and steel often comes down to the specific requirements of the application and the user's performance goals.
